About This Product

• THE HIGHEST QUALITY LEDS: 365nm UV Nichia LEDs with long lifetime and high efficiency, and long-range 60-foot light beam!
• PROFESSIONAL GRADE FILTERS: High quality ZWB2 (black glass) filter allowing for transmission of pure 365nm UV
• WHAT’S INCLUDED: (1) Flashlight, (2) 18650s rechargeable batteries, a battery charger and wall adaptor

Technical Specs

• Constant 1.5A Drive Current
• Beam Angle: 8-12 Degrees
• 2.7W of radiant UVA power
• ZWB2 (black glass) filter
• Energy efficient switching regulator drive enables flashlight to run cooler and longer
• Flashlight safely shuts down when batteries are near depletion
• Runtime: 2 Hours

UV is harmful to the eyesight of all living creatures.  The use of UV-blocking eye protection is strongly recommended. UV lights should be only used by adults or under adult supervision, with proper instruction and knowledge. UV lights should be used to illuminate objects only, never anyone/anything that has eyes.
